Motion alarm triggers police check at crescent city building, Crescent City CA
Heads up: This post was detected from real-time dispatch audio. Information may be incomplete, and the situation may evolve. Always verify using official agency releases.
Police responded to a motion sensor alarm at the lobby double doors of a building near Northcrest Drive in Crescent City. Officers inspected the front and rear of the building and found no signs of break-in or suspicious activity.
